Silves Beer Fest 2026 is over: five days on Praça Al-Mutamid, at the foot of the castle, from 15 to 19 July, given over to Portugal’s craft beer scene — with nothing to pay at the gate. If you landed here looking for the next event in Silves, the answer is at the bottom of this page.
How much did Silves Beer Fest 2026 cost?
Nothing. Entry was free across all five days — you paid only for what you drank and ate, sold at the producers’ own stalls. There were no tickets, no wristbands and no advance sales, and that is how the festival has run since it started. The event history stays on the Silves council website.
What was at Silves Beer Fest 2026?
Craft beers from producers across Portugal, a broad food offering, and a bill mixing covers and tribute bands, Portuguese popular music, rock, world sounds, DJ sets and comedy. There was also a Fun Zone aimed at younger visitors — the format was firmly a family summer party rather than a tasting session for purists.
When is Silves Beer Fest 2027?
The 2027 dates have not been announced. The festival has settled into mid-July, so the week of 14-18 July 2027 is the reasonable guess — but nothing is confirmed, and we will update this page as soon as the council publishes its calendar.
In the meantime, anyone heading to the Algarve in August will not go short of a packed square: the beer festival is the warm-up for the town’s big summer event, and the Silves Medieval Fair takes over the old town from 7 to 15 August, with day tickets at 2 euros under the theme “Xilb, City of Poets and Scholars”.
